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Beach Acronychia | three-ranked bristle moss |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Bryophyta |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Bryopsida (Bryopsida) |
| Order | Sapindales (Sapindales) | Grimmiales (Grimmiales) |
| Family | Rutaceae | Seligeriaceae |
| Genus | Acronychia | Seligeria |
| Species | Acronychia imperforata | Seligeria tristichoides |
Evolutionary Relationship
Beach Acronychia and three-ranked bristle moss share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Plantae. (Plants)
